This Song Will Save Your Life by Leila Sales

Publication:September 17th 2013 by Farrar, Straus and Giroux (BYR)

Goodreads Description:
Making friends has never been Elise Dembowski’s strong suit. All throughout her life, she’s been the butt of every joke and the outsider in every conversation. When a final attempt at popularity fails, Elise nearly gives up. Then she stumbles upon a warehouse party where she meets Vicky, a girl in a band who accepts her; Char, a cute, yet mysterious disc jockey; Pippa, a carefree spirit from England; and most importantly, a love for DJing.

Told in a refreshingly genuine and laugh-out-loud funny voice, This Song Will Save Your Life is an exuberant novel about identity, friendship, and the power of music to bring people together.


My thoughts:
This Song Will Save Your Life is a good book but by no means amazing. Personally I didn't love it.

I usually love a book if I love the characters so I think a big reason why I didn't like This Song Will Save Your Live was because I didn't like Elise. I couldn't relate to her at all and she was so annoying in the beginning with the whole 'I need to change to be cool and impress people' thing going on. Maybe if I'd read this when I was younger I might have liked her better. But I just think you should never change to impress people so her thoughts in the beginning were so irritating to me. She was so judgy as well- she constantly made judgements about people who she didn't even know-it annoyed me so much. She bashed on music she wasn't into, musicians, her classmates, everything! She was so hypocritical- she didn't want other people to judge her and she was going around judging them!

I felt like the story was way too short. The characters were not fleshed out enough for me to care about them and the relationships weren't developed enough. I didn't care about Elise's new friendships with these people because I didn't know these people.

I didn't like the ending. A lot stuff was just left hanging and I wanted more closure.

I did like the message of the story but I wanted more from it. It is a story about finding yourself and doing what makes you happy regardless of what others think but I felt like it could have been executed better. I think it's  great message but it's more aimed at younger teens which is why I don't think I enjoyed it much.


Overall, This Song Will Save Your Life, didn't leave a lasting impression on me. I thought it was okay but nothing special. 

My Rating: 3 stars
